Frequently Asked Questions about Jacksonville
How much are Studio apartments in Jacksonville?
There are currently 537 Studio Apartments in Jacksonville with rent ranges from $367 to $3,434 with an average price of $1,330.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Jacksonville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Jacksonville ranges from $500 to $3,215 with an average monthly rent of $1,433.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Jacksonville c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Jacksonville range from $647 to $115,000.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,719.
How expensive are Jacksonville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 558 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Jacksonville on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$946 to $9,195 - averaging $2,072 for the location.
